Time the record covers

At least 45 million years on record.

The record covers at least 182.9 Mya to 137.05 Mya. No occurrence read is dated outside 184.2 Mya to 132.6 Mya.

164 occurrences of Higumastra on record, most of them in the Middle Jurassic. Bar height is expected occurrences, not a count: each fossil is spread across the span it is dated to, so a tall narrow bar means tight dating and a low wide one means loose.

When

164 occurrences

These are dates about fossils, not the animal: the record can only begin after it arose and end before it died out, so either end may reach further. Shares are expected occurrences: a fossil dated to a span is counted partly in each period it straddles. More on what this infers.

Found in

27 formations

Ameghino — 64.47°S, 58.97°WSnowshoe — 44.13°N, 119.12°WSnowshoe — 44.13°N, 118.97°WSnowshoe — 44.08°N, 119.38°WHyde — 44.07°N, 119.41°WJosephine — 41.87°N, 123.83°WWahrah — 22.97°N, 57.06°EWahrah — 22.74°N, 57.26°EAnchorage — 62.60°S, 61.17°WOberalmer Schichten — 47.73°N, 13.03°EOberalmer Schichten — 47.62°N, 13.25°ETaman — 21.28°N, 98.82°WUnit 1 — 35.05°N, 120.17°WMonte Alpe Cherts — 44.37°N, 9.43°EGraham Island — 53.40°N, 132.27°WNadan — 23.02°N, 57.11°EShelikof — 57.75°N, 155.47°WUnit 2 — 35.05°N, 120.17°WFonzaso — 46.05°N, 11.88°ESchrambach-Schichten — 47.73°N, 13.03°EPhantom Creek — 53.39°N, 132.27°WGuwayza — 23.01°N, 57.76°EGuwayza — 22.89°N, 57.74°ESid'r — 22.82°N, 56.89°ESid'r — 22.89°N, 57.74°ERosso ad Aptici — 45.88°N, 8.64°ESoccher — 46.19°N, 12.30°EAptychus Beds — 47.67°N, 12.90°ELonesome — 44.08°N, 119.50°WXialu Chert — 29.02°N, 89.03°E

The named rock units Higumastra has been recovered from, largest first. Drawn where the rock is now, not where it formed. 3 further formations hold fewer occurrences each and are not listed. 43 occurrences have no formation on record, which is common for older literature.
